Step 2 · Remove the Faucet Handle

This is the step people usually slow down on. Go finger-tight first, then a quarter turn. No rush — replay the clip whenever it helps.

Carefully remove the faucet handle. Most handles have a small decorative cap that needs to be pried off (using a small flathead screwdriver or similar tool) to reveal the screw securing the handle. Unscrew this with the appropriate screwdriver (usually a Phillips head). Once the screw is removed, gently pull off the handle.
